Monday, January 10, 2011. If It's Not Baroque, Don't Fix It (The Baroque Period). The Baroque Era was a style or period of music in Europe between 1600 and 1750. The word Baroque itself means "a pearl of irregular shape" and finds it's origin in the Portuguese language. At first used more describing art then music, it was used to imply abnormality, strangeness, and extravangance. The music of the Baroque time was characterized by rich counterpoint. Autumn's Music Appreciation Blog. Thursday, April 7, 2011. Because a cat's the only cat who REALLY knows where it's at! Swing music is a form of jazz that developed in the early 1930's and became very popular by 1935. Swing is simply just a different feel to the eighth notes in a song. Instead of playing just straight 1&2& patterns you give it a little "swing." Swing bands usually featured soloists. Was the dominant form of American popular music from 1935 to 1945.
